Abstract :
The problem of reliable controllers design was considered for a class of uncertain interconnected large-scale nonlinear systems with constant time delays, parameter uncertainties and nonlinear disturbances. The nonlinearities were assumed to satisfy the boundedness conditions. Different from common discrete model, a more practical model of actuator failures was considered for the continuous gain model. The purpose of the paper was to design linear memoryless state feedback decentralized controllers to stabilize the systems. By solving the LMI, we get the controllers which make the systems be asymptotically stable when actuators experience failures. At last a simulation example is presented to show that the state feedback controllers are effective
